serpentine belt re-route after smog and A/C delete
I have a bone stock '91 RS with a TBI 305. I am going to remove the A/C and smog pump. How do I go about re-routing the serpentine belt without switching the water pump to a non-serpentine one?
You can reroute the belt if you remove the air pump.There is a tech article on this site that shows a pic of the new routinging, using a different lenth belt.
I you want to remove the AC,you have to get a dummy pulley from GM.This pully was in the non-AC F-bodies.It goes where the AC was, and weighs about 2 lbs.
Email me if you want the GM part#.Its about $30 From you dealer. I have this setup on my 90 TA.

you can use the exsisting idler pulley, just have to go OVER it, and also change the upper radiator hose to autozones number XL449, its from a 69 camaro. If you like I can send you a pic of the way it is on my 92.
